Job Title: Test Operator (1st and 2nd shift Weekend Shift)
Job Description
The Test Operator on the 1st weekend shift performs in‑process and final testing of electrical control panels and heat exchange units in a highly automated, clean manufacturing environment. You support production by executing electrical tests, assisting with troubleshooting and repairs, documenting results, and collaborating closely with electrical assembly technicians to ensure products meet quality and compliance standards.
Responsibilities
- Perform in‑process and final testing on the electrical components of control panels in accordance with established procedures and metrics.
- Use test equipment such as multimeters, voltmeters, and ohmmeters to verify electrical performance and identify potential issues.
- Test automated In Row Heat Exchange units, following detailed training on the specific processes and equipment used.
- Troubleshoot, debug, and diagnose electrical faults based on defined performance metrics and test results.
- Work closely with electrical assembly technicians to resolve issues, suggest possible repairs, and ensure timely completion of units.
- Conduct compliance reporting using Excel, accurately documenting test results, issues found, and corrective actions taken.
- Read and interpret electrical schematics, prints, and related documentation to guide testing and troubleshooting activities.
- Assist in the build and manufacture of fixtures and tooling as required to support testing processes and meet customer expectations.
- Apply knowledge of current flow, AC/DC systems, and switchgear to ensure safe and effective testing and fault diagnosis.
- Operate a personal computer using a Windows-based operating system and related software to run tests, record data, and complete documentation.
- Define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ions when investigating test failures or anomalies.
- Follow all safety guidelines, including proper use of tools, test equipment, and personal protective equipment, while maintaining a clean and organized work area.
- Collaborate with team members in a quiet, team‑oriented environment to meet production goals and quality standards during the weekend shift.
Essential Skills
- At least 2 years of experience in electronics, electromechanical, or electrical testing in a manufacturing environment, or equivalent technical education.
- Proficient ability to perform electrical troubleshooting on control panels and related equipment.
- Hands‑on experience using test equipment such as multimeters, voltmeters, and ohmmeters.
- Capable of reading and interpreting electrical schematics, blueprints, or prints.
- Knowledge of AC/DC systems and switchgear, including understanding of current flow.
- Ability to troubleshoot, debug, and diagnose electrical faults based on test metrics and data.
- Proficient use of a personal computer with a Windows-based operating system and related software.
- Ability to use Excel for compliance reporting and documentation of test results.
- Strong analytical skills with the 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ions.
- Solid math skills, including the ability to add, subtract, multiply, and divide in all units of measure using whole numbers, common fractions, and decimals.
- Ability to work a 1st weekend shift schedule (6:00 AM – 6:30 PM Friday, Saturday, and Sunday).
